Garrett and Carter went to the movies last weekend. Together they bought 2 drinks and 2 popcorns. They spent a total of $12.50.
-BARSIC- [3]

The cost of one drink is $2.50 and cost of one popcorn is $3.75

<u><em>Explanation</em></u>

Suppose, the cost of one drink is x dollar and cost of one popcorn is y dollar.

Given that, total cost for 2 drinks and 2 popcorns is $12.50  and  total cost for 6 drinks and 5 popcorns is $33.75

So, the system of equations will be......

2x+2y=12.50 ..................................... (1)\\ \\ 6x+5y= 33.75 ..................................... (2)

Multiplying equation (1) by -3 , we will get.....

-3(2x+2y)=-3(12.50)\\ \\ -6x-6y=-37.50 ..................................... (3)

Now, adding equation (2) and equation (3) , we will get ............

5y-6y=33.75-37.50\\ \\ -y=-3.75\\ \\ y=3.75

Plugging this y=3.75 into equation (1) ......

2x+2(3.75)=12.50\\ \\ 2x+7.50=12.50\\ \\ 2x=12.50-7.50=5\\ \\ x=\frac{5}{2}=2.50

So, the cost of one drink is $2.50 and cost of one popcorn is $3.75

Each of the 25 balls in a certain box is either red, blue or white and has a number from 1 to 10 painted on it. If one ball is t
Aneli [31]

Answer:

Not sufficient information

Step-by-step explanation:

Probability of white ball: P(W)

Probability of even number: P(E)

Probability of white ball or even number: P(W∨E) is asked

Considering case (1):

Probability of white ball and even number: P(W∧E) = 0

And we know that,

P(W∨E) = P(W) + P(E) - P(W∧E) = P(W) + P(E) - 0 = P(W) + P(E)

It is not sufficient to calculate the desired probability.

Considering case (2):

P(W) - P(E) = 0.2

Here, it is possible for P(W) and P(E) to get multiply values.

So P(W∨E) cannot be determined.

Considering cases (1) & (2):

P(W∧E) = 0 and P(W) - P(E) = 0.2

So, P(W∨E) = P(W) + P(E) = P(E) + 0.2 + P(E) = 2P(E) + 0.2

Again multiple answers are possible.

Such as, for P(E) = 0.4 (10 even balls) ⇒ P(W∨E) = 1

but for P(E) = 0.2 (5 even balls) ⇒ P(W∨E) = 0.6

So, the information are not sufficient.
